President Weah pays real estate taxes through mobile money tax payment service

Monrovia,Liberia: President George Weah has admonished Liberians to contribute to the country’s fiscal envelope by being tax compliant.

President Weah said payment of taxes can boost revenue generation as well as aid the country realize the right kind of infrastructure development.

At the officially launched of the LRA mobile tax payment platform Thursday, the Liberian Leader used the occasion by being the first in paying his real property tax through the mobile tax payment platform.

He however commended the LRA for instituting measures that enhance the participation of Liberians in paying their taxes.

The LRA Commissioner General,  Madam Elfrieda Stewart Tamba said the launched of the platform is intended to encourage voluntary compliance through payment of taxes.

According to Madam Tamba, such mobile tax platform created will alleviate some constraints faced by Liberians when paying their lawful revenue.

Also at the occasion was  USAID Mission Director Anthony Chan, who  expressed joy for the mobile tax platform something he stated will enable the Liberian Government achieve the needed developmental initiatives.
